Bartholomew
Originally released in 2017. Bartholomew is a comedy film. directed by Elizabeth Becker. At just 20 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Trevor Tordjman, Melissa Dakers, and Karen Gaulin
Synopsis
Bartholomew is a socially awkward young man with a flair for disco music and a love of the 1970s. He makes desperate attempts to find a girlfriend who shares his interests.
